G80 Electrified Center Caps

This is an update to my previous post. I think I'll settle on this design. I removed the lobes that covered the lug bolt holes to make installation easier. I also made a conical insert that goes on the back of the wheel and a front plate, and these get screwed together. then the large center cap gets screwed onto the inserts. I made a set of inserts and a cap out of PLA and drove for a week (about 600 miles) with a mix of highway driving up to 90mph, regular suburban traffic, and stop-and-go rush hour traffic and they held up just fine, so I think heat from the brakes is a non-issue. Final one will be made out of ASA-GF and I'll apply a clear coat as well.

I was thinking of applying a metal-effect wrap to the raised parts to follow the spokes of the wheels, as well as the emblem, but that seemed like a lot of work to make look good, so instead I made little lines that follow the spokes and I used the AMS in my Bambu P2S to make it work. I'm pretty happy with the result.
